288 people were killed and nearly 900 injured in the Odisha train mishap. Three-train collision in Balasore is said to be India’s deadliest accident in over 20 years. Prime Minister Narendra Modi visited the train crash site. PM Modi also met with the injured at the hospitals in Cuttack. Railway Minister Ashwini Vaishnaw said a high-level probe will be conducted. Odisha CM Naveen Patnaik has declared one-day mourning. The Railway Minister announced compensation of Rs 10 lakh for the families of those who have died.
